The CGOA had a Chapter Challenge recently.  They challenged chapters to crochet 7x9 rectangles for Warm UP America.  My chapter participated and crocheted a lot of rectangles.  Since I wasn't able to participate in the crocheting of rectangles, I picked up a bunch of rectangles to sew together on Sunday.  Once we sew them all together the blankets will be donated locally.
